St. Joseph County Police warning of scammers driving “asphalt” truck

(Photo supplied/St. Joseph County Police Department)

St. Joseph County Police are warning of scammers in the area.

Police say three Hispanic men are driving a white truck that says “asphalt.”

They’re posing as tree service workers contracted with the electric company.

Their goal is to get you outside your home so that while you’re distracted, they can enter your home and steal items.

Police say if you have not called a contractor to your home, do not let them in and call police.
